Accessories

1. Overview

Development board accessories are essential components that extend the functionality of microcontroller/processor development platforms. These accessories include interface cables, power modules, sensor modules, expansion boards, and debugging tools that enable rapid prototyping and system integration. As core enablers for embedded system development, IoT prototyping, and industrial automation, these accessories significantly reduce development time while improving hardware compatibility and measurement accuracy.

2. Main Types and Functional Classification

TypeFunctional FeaturesApplication Examples
Interface CablesHigh-speed data transfer, hot-plugging supportUSB-UART converters, HDMI breakout cables
Power ModulesRegulated voltage output, battery managementLipo battery packs, DC-DC converters
Sensor ModulesDigital/analog signal acquisition, calibration-freeTemperature/humidity sensors, IMUs
Expansion BoardsPeripheral interface extension, protocol conversionMotor drivers, LoRaWAN shields
Debugging ToolsReal-time tracing, voltage measurementJTAG probes, logic analyzers

3. Structure and Composition

Typical accessories feature: - Hardware Shell: Flame-retardant ABS or CNC-machined aluminum for mechanical protection - Interface Circuits: Level shifters and ESD protection components - Communication Modules: SPI/I2C/UART protocol converters - Power Conditioning: Voltage regulators and current limiting circuits - Mechanical Components: Mounting brackets and anti-vibration pads

7. Selection Guide

Key considerations: - Project requirements: Match sensor types and communication protocols - Compatibility: Verify voltage levels and physical dimensions - Expandability: Check available GPIO and bus interfaces - Cost-effectiveness: Balance performance vs. budget - Environmental factors: Temperature range and vibration resistance - Support ecosystem: Availability of libraries and community resources

8. Industry Trends

Emerging trends include: - Wireless integration (Bluetooth/WiFi 6 modules) - AI-enabled sensor fusion algorithms - Modular system-in-package (SiP) designs - Open-source hardware standardization - Energy-harvesting power solutions - Increased adoption of 2.54mm standardization
